Riffy, you are talking about pre-coning, where the manufacturer sets the coning angle at the expected angle for minimal stresses under normal conditions.
Therefore, at flat pitch on the ground, there is a downwards stress on the head (blades not coning up at all) and at the end of an auto or under heavy load, there is an upwards stress - these heads can't please everybody all the time. Fully articulated are able to sort themselves out.
